Bronze Cross - Lifesaving Society
The Lifesaving Society’s Bronze Cross begins the transition
from lifesaving to lifeguarding and prepares candidates for
responsibilities as an assistant lifeguard. Candidates strengthen and expand
their lifesaving skills and begin to apply the principles and techniques
of active surveillance in aquatic facilities. Bronze Cross emphasized the
importance of teamwork and communication in preventing and responding
to aquatic emergencies. Bronze Cross is a pre-requisite for advanced training
in the Society’s National Lifeguard and leadership certification programs.
Pre-requisite(s): 14 years of age, Bronze Medallion and Intermediate First
Aid CPR-C & AED.
